> I wonder, have you ever considered using hardlinks? It seems to me that
> would eliminate a lot of problems people have mirroring things (if mirror
> programs handle them correctly), and simplify your work too. 

Mirror doesn't handle them correctly.  From the mirror man page:

       Mirror can handle symbolic links but not  ordinary  links.
       It  does not duplicate owner or group information.  If you
       require any of these options, use rdist(1) instead.

Since mirror doesn't understand them, all the debian mirrors would
suddenly bloat tremendously.
